Sustainability as a concept remains just as challenging and
important today as it was when the first edition of this book was
published. The Second Edition of Sustainability and Design Ethics
explores the ethical obligations of knowledgeable people such as
design professionals, taking into consideration the numerous
changes that have taken place in recent years. This book expands
the growing discussion on the principles of sustainability to
further include the role of businesses and governments and
considers the general recognition that modern society has occurred
at the expense of nature with significant social and environmental
impacts. Are there limits to the individual's ethical obligation?
How do such obligations change or adapt to a world of sustainable
design? As the shift toward sustainability proceeds, designers'
ethical underpinnings will be confronted with a wider range of
people and concerns whose interests must be weighed. The design
professionals are likely to be among the lead in the shift toward
sustainability because of the special knowledge and expertise
provided to them by their education, experience, and distinctive
position in society. The entire world of design is being reassessed
and the guiding principles and ethics of design reflect this
change. New to the Second Edition: Expanded international scope
that includes a comparison of professional organizations in the EU,
Australia, Canada, Japan and China Discusses how cultural
differences between the West and China result in different
underlying foundations for professional ethics Revised analyses to
reflect changes in regulatory and technical areas such as the
inevitable rise of artificial intelligence in design Updated
arguments reflecting the need for sustainability and the designer's
role and obligations Updated references pertaining to the progress
of sustainable design and development Sustainability and Design
Ethics, Second Edition is an attempt to explore the ideas and
principles that might contribute to the thinking of thoughtful
design professionals. The emergence of "green" design discussed in
this book is used to evidence progress, but also to demonstrate the
degree to which more is needed.
